中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

自定義Python quad函數積分策略

小樊
84
2024-08-07 05:56:20
欄目: 編程語言

示例代碼:

def quad_custom(func, a, b, N=1000):
    dx = (b - a) / N
    integral = 0
    for i in range(N):
        x1 = a + i*dx
        x2 = a + (i+1)*dx
        integral += func(x1) * dx
    return integral

# 定義要積分的函數
def f(x):
    return x**2

# 使用自定義的積分策略進行積分
result = quad_custom(f, 0, 1)
print(result)

在上面的代碼中,quad_custom 函數接受一個函數 func、積分區間 [a, b] 和可選的積分精度 N,并返回對函數 func[a, b] 區間上的積分值。這個函數使用矩形法計算積分,將積分區間分成 N 個小矩形,并計算每個小矩形的面積,然后將它們相加得到總的積分值。

在示例中,我們定義了一個函數 f(x) = x**2,然后使用自定義的積分策略 quad_custom 對這個函數在區間 [0, 1] 上進行積分。最后打印出積分結果。

0
承德县| 新丰县| 苍南县| 墨脱县| 通许县| 尚志市| 汾阳市| 德化县| 沁阳市| 高邑县| 繁昌县| 岱山县| 江源县| 二手房| 新丰县| 永嘉县| 昭通市| 含山县| 宁波市| 布拖县| 阿鲁科尔沁旗| 津市市| 剑阁县| 宜兰县| 娄烦县| 嘉祥县| 青阳县| 原平市| 大名县| 平利县| 湘乡市| 长兴县| 横山县| 慈利县| 潞城市| 盐边县| 大丰市| 紫阳县| 安福县| 天柱县| 彩票|